博客 指标归因分析的数据建模与实现方法

指标归因分析的数据建模与实现方法

   数栈君   发表于 2026-01-18 08:39  100  0

在数字化转型的浪潮中,企业越来越依赖数据驱动的决策。指标归因分析作为一种重要的数据分析方法,帮助企业理解各项业务指标之间的因果关系,从而优化资源配置、提升运营效率。本文将深入探讨指标归因分析的数据建模与实现方法,为企业提供实用的指导。


什么是指标归因分析?

指标归因分析(Metric Attributed Analysis)是一种通过数据建模,识别不同因素对业务指标影响程度的方法。其核心目标是回答以下问题:

  • 哪些因素对业务指标的增长或下降贡献最大?
  • 各个因素之间的相互作用如何影响最终结果?
  • 如何通过调整某些因素来优化业务表现?

通过指标归因分析,企业可以更精准地制定策略,例如在营销活动中确定哪些渠道贡献最大,或者在产品优化中识别哪些功能对用户留存率影响最大。


指标归因分析的常见应用场景

  1. 市场营销:分析不同渠道、广告投放、促销活动对销售额的贡献。
  2. 产品优化:评估产品功能、用户体验对用户活跃度、留存率的影响。
  3. 运营效率:分析资源分配、流程优化对成本、效率的提升效果。
  4. 风险管理:识别影响业务稳定性的关键风险因素。

指标归因分析的数据建模方法

指标归因分析的核心在于构建数学模型,量化各因素对业务指标的影响。以下是常见的建模方法:

1. 线性回归模型

线性回归是最常用的指标归因分析方法之一。其基本假设是业务指标与各因素之间存在线性关系。模型形式如下:

[ Y = \beta_0 + \beta_1 X_1 + \beta_2 X_2 + \dots + \beta_n X_n + \epsilon ]

其中:

  • ( Y ) 是业务指标。
  • ( X_1, X_2, \dots, X_n ) 是影响 ( Y ) 的各因素。
  • ( \beta_0, \beta_1, \dots, \beta_n ) 是回归系数,表示各因素对 ( Y ) 的影响程度。
  • ( \epsilon ) 是误差项。

步骤

  1. 数据清洗与特征工程:确保数据质量,处理缺失值、异常值。
  2. 特征选择:根据业务需求选择相关因素。
  3. 模型训练:使用历史数据拟合线性回归模型。
  4. 模型评估:通过 R²、调整后的 R² 等指标评估模型的解释力。
  5. 结果解读:分析各回归系数的正负及其绝对值大小,判断各因素对指标的影响方向和程度。

2. 非线性回归模型

当业务指标与因素之间的关系非线性时,可以使用非线性回归模型,例如多项式回归、逻辑回归等。这种方法适用于复杂场景,但模型复杂度较高,需要更多的数据支持。

3. 随机森林与梯度提升树

随机森林(Random Forest)和梯度提升树(如 XGBoost、LightGBM)是基于树的集成学习方法,适合处理高维数据和非线性关系。这些方法不仅能提供各因素的重要性评分,还能自动处理特征交互。

优势

  • 对特征工程要求较低。
  • 能处理高维数据和非线性关系。
  • 具有较高的模型解释力。

4. 时间序列分析

当业务指标具有时间依赖性时,可以使用时间序列分析方法,例如 ARIMA、Prophet 等。这些方法可以帮助识别时间趋势、季节性变化以及外部因素对指标的影响。


指标归因分析的实现步骤

  1. 明确分析目标:确定需要分析的业务指标和影响因素。
  2. 数据准备
    • 收集相关数据,包括业务指标和影响因素。
    • 数据清洗:处理缺失值、异常值。
    • 特征工程:提取特征、进行数据变换(如标准化、对数变换)。
  3. 选择建模方法:根据业务场景和数据特点选择合适的模型。
  4. 模型训练与评估:使用训练数据拟合模型,并通过验证数据评估模型性能。
  5. 结果分析
    • 解读模型系数或特征重要性评分。
    • 识别关键影响因素及其贡献程度。
  6. 可视化与报告:将分析结果以图表形式呈现,便于业务团队理解和应用。

指标归因分析的可视化与数字孪生应用

指标归因分析的结果可以通过数据可视化工具进行动态展示,帮助企业更好地理解和应用数据。以下是常见的可视化方式:

  1. 贡献度分析图:通过柱状图或饼图展示各因素对业务指标的贡献程度。
  2. 交互式仪表盘:使用数字孪生技术构建交互式仪表盘,用户可以实时调整参数,观察不同因素对指标的影响。
  3. 热力图:展示各因素对指标的正负影响,帮助识别关键驱动因素。

工具与平台推荐

为了高效地进行指标归因分析,企业可以选择以下工具和平台:

  1. 开源工具
    • Python:使用 pandasnumpy 进行数据处理,使用 scikit-learnxgboost 进行模型训练。
    • R:使用 lm() 函数进行线性回归分析。
  2. 大数据平台
    • Hadoop:适用于大规模数据处理。
    • Flink:适用于实时数据分析。
  3. 可视化工具
    • Tableau:强大的数据可视化工具。
    • Power BI:微软的商业智能工具。
  4. 数字孪生平台
    • Unity:适用于构建交互式数字孪生模型。
    • Blender:适用于 3D 可视化场景。

总结

指标归因分析是企业数据驱动决策的重要工具,通过科学的建模方法和高效的实现手段,帮助企业识别关键影响因素,优化资源配置。结合数据中台、数字孪生和数字可视化技术,企业可以更直观地理解和应用分析结果,提升竞争力。

如果您希望进一步了解指标归因分析的实现方法,或者需要相关工具的支持,可以申请试用我们的解决方案: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料